For his first two years, Pico lived in a house with a dog door and a nice yard and he got really good about going out whenever he needed to go. Unfortunately I had to move where I couldn't keep him for the year. For a few months he stayed with my girlfriend who took him out on a leash. That didn't work so well b/c she and her roommates were regularly gone for long periods of time and Pico's bladder isn't so big. He's now living with my mom, who has a much more regular schedule and can walk him in the morning and early afternoon and so his accidents have decreased dramatically.
Now here's the fun part for my poor confused friend. I will be moving to an apartment that allows dogs in a few weeks but he won't have a dog door and I won't be able to walk him regularly like my mom does. I was thinking about trying to litter train him, at least for the mid day when he is home alone, and then doing the leash thing at night (at least when the weather is nice). Is this feasible? And will I go crazy trying to teach him?
I'll probably have about a week of being at home all day before i will have to start leaving the house regularly again. Will this be enough time to get him at least pretty far on his way to being litter trained?
